Housing and heating context

HVAC planning for Jacksonville Beach's mixed building types

Jacksonville Beach has a comparatively newer housing mix, the city includes a mixed-density housing profile, owner and renter occupancy are both prominent. Electricity and utility gas are the two largest reported home-heating fuel categories. These citywide measures provide context for access, scheduling, ventilation, electrical needs, and phased project planning; each property still requires its own assessment.

3.2%
of housing units were built in 1939 or earlier
45.6%
are in structures with two or more units
31.2%
of occupied units are renter occupied

Primary home-heating fuel

Share of occupied units
Utility gas3.3%
Electricity93.9%
Oil or kerosene0.2%
Propane1.3%
Other or no fuel1.1%

Can Green Flow install or replace heat pumps in Jacksonville Beach?

Yes. Green Flow can review ducted, ductless, multi-zone, hybrid, and replacement heat-pump projects in Jacksonville Beach. Planning may include the existing heating and cooling system, comfort goals, electrical readiness, airflow, equipment placement, and whether the work should be completed at once or in phases.

What heating and cooling equipment can Green Flow service in Jacksonville Beach?

Service requests in Jacksonville Beach can include heat pumps, ductless mini splits, furnaces, central air-conditioning systems, packaged and rooftop units, air handlers, thermostats, controls, and indoor-air-quality equipment. Providing the model number, visible error code, system age if known, and photos can help route the request.
